英文摘要The interfacial shear strength of SiCf/Ti-6Al-4V composites was investigated by the fiber push-out method. The results showed that the interfacial shear strength between c-coated, uncoated fiber and the matrix reached 118.2 MPa and 230 MPa, respectively. The interfacial debonding occured between the C-coating or SiC fiber and the interfacial reaction layer. After annealing treatment at 500 degrees C, 600 degrees C and 800 degrees C, the interfacial shear strength was lower than that of the as-fabricated samples. The strength trends decreasing after annealing at 500 degrees C and a little increasing after annealing at 600 degrees C and 800 degrees C. Debonding possibly took place at interfaces of matrix/interfacial reaction products and C-coating or SiC fiber/interfacial reaction products after treated at 800 degrees C.
